2012 TBLA #11 Dodger Prospect Vote

This post will serve as the voting for the Dodgers #11 Prospect heading into the 2012 season. Please vote only once, and limit the comments in this post to your selection. Voting will be open from now until 7 am PST tomorrow morning (12/1).

Click here for the discussion post on the main page that has additional information regarding each prospect, and also use that thread to talk about this vote.

Again, the candidates for this vote are:

Alfredo Silverio - OF (24.5 years old)

Angelo Songco - 1B (23 years old) -

Alex Santana - 3B (18.25 years old)

Ethan Martin - RHP (22.5 years old)

Jonathan Garcia - OF (20 years old)

Aaron Miller - LHP (24 years old)

Angel Sanchez - RHP (22 years old)

Alex Castellanos - OF (25.25 years old)

Griff Erickson - C (23.5 years old)

Scott Van Slyke - OF/1B (25.25 years old)

Blake Smith - OF (23.75 years old)

Kyle Russell - OF (25.25 years old)

Jake Lemmerman - SS (22.5 years old)
